May 15, 1890.

Mr. Donlon
When you come home I want you to look into the case I hear of in Los Angeles. yesterday. Mr & Mrs Wentz and [unknown] Smith of Philadelphia was here and they were treated by one of the waiters in a shameful manner. Somewhat similar to other complain
They said they spoke to you to have [unknown] changed [unknown] and that they did not notice the waiter in the dining room the next day.
Do you remember the particulars and can you give them to me.

E. S. B. Jr.

May 15. 1890.

Robert Barnsdale,
Is our range so constructed in the Hotel so that by a system of pipes in one part of it we can heat hot water enough for the Hotel to do its dish-washing and heating of dishes and at the same time use the fire for some kind of cooking?

E. S. B. Jr.
